Problem
The existing FD MIMO system's CSI feedback approach is inflexible and cannot support the feedback of various CSI-related information after measurement, particularly in scenarios requiring beamformed or non-precoded CSI measurement pilots.
Innovation Solution
A method and device for feeding back channel state information in an FD MIMO system, where a terminal receives CSI feedback configurations and configuration information from a base station, allowing for flexible CSI feedback modes, including beam-formed and non-precoded transmission modes, and specific indications for PUCCH and PUSCH channels, enabling the terminal to measure and report CSI accordingly.

The present invention discloses a channel state information (CSI) feedback method and related device for an FD MIMO system, and is configured to support the scenario in which various CSI related information needs to be fed back after a CSI measurement in an FD MIMO system. The method comprises: a terminal receives a CSI feedback configuration group indicated by a base station and configuration information for performing a CSI feedback based on the CSI feedback configuration group; and the terminal performs a CSI measurement and feedback according to the CSI feedback configuration group and the configuration information, wherein the CSI feedback configuration group comprises at least one CSI feedback configuration, and the CSI feedback configuration is a downlink signal configuration for a downlink CSI measurement and feedback.
